Paper Tables...

One of our science standards is in the area of technology and engineering.  Specifically, it is that a student, "... applies the principles of the engineering/design process (ask, imagine, plan, create, improve) to solve a problem...".  Today, students in 3 K/M were asked to design a table, made from no more than ten sheets of newspaper and masking tape, that was at least eight inches high and could hold our social studies textbook... for at least five minutes.  Our class took on this challenge with excitement and engineering all wrapped up in one!  We discussed good strategies and planning, along with specific engineering principles such as "load distribution" and the concept of a "truss".  So far, two of our seven working groups have been able to create the table (after several tests and "improvements")... others are on their way!  Check out some designs:
